Pakistan’s biggest brewery is evolving from its 165-year-old liquor legacy

July 04, 2025 9:01 pm

The company is an outlier in a country where alcohol is outlawed for everyone except non-Muslims, who make up some 9 million people out of 241 million. Pakistan, an Islamic republic, banned booze for Muslims in the 1970s.

Pakistan boosts defence budget by 20% but slashes overall spending in 2025-26

June 10, 2025 11:44 pm

The budget presented on Tuesday by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if's government allocated 2.55 trillion rupees ($9 billion) to defence in July-June 2025-26, up from 2.12 trillion.
